# xwayland enable|disable|force
|
|
# - enable: lazily launch xwayland on first client connection
|
|
# - disable: never launch xwayland
|
|
# - force: launch xwayland immediately on boot
|
|
# XWayland exposes a X11 server that translates the protocol to a wayland backend, allowing legacy x11-only GUI apps.
|
|
# XWayland uses about 35MB RSS even when idle
|
|
xwayland @xwayland@

# manually export PATH here, since all my user services need that, and sane-sandboxed implementation depends on it.
|
|
# also, manually export XDG_DATA_DIRS. glib fails in weird ways (e.g. thinks everything is application/x-octet-stream mime type) without it.
|
|
# for more, see: <repo:nixos/nixpkgs:nixos/modules/programs/wayland/sway.nix>
|
|
#
|
|
# XXX: dbus-update-activation-environment --systemd is ASYNCHRONOUS. it returns before the systemd environment is actually updated.
|
|
# hence, call `systemctl import-environment` ourselves. i could probably remove the dbus stuff and be safe, but at least for now it's an OK backup.
|
|
exec --no-startup-id systemctl --user import-environment PATH XDG_DATA_DIRS DISPLAY WAYLAND_DISPLAY SWAYSOCK XDG_CURRENT_DESKTOP
|
|
exec --no-startup-id dbus-update-activation-environment --systemd PATH XDG_DATA_DIRS DISPLAY WAYLAND_DISPLAY SWAYSOCK XDG_CURRENT_DESKTOP

# signal to systemd that sway is active,
|
|
# and therefore let it start any downstream services (e.g. apps that would like to auto-start)
|
|
# see `systemctl --user cat sway-session` for links to docs
|
|
exec --no-startup-id systemctl start --user sway-session.service
